The Role
We're looking for an enthusiastic and detail-driven SEO Lead to join our Norwich city centre office. You'll support the day-to-day delivery of SEO campaigns across a range of clients, helping to boost organic traffic, improve visibility, and track performance.
This role is ideal for someone with 1-2 years' experience in SEO who thrives in a fast-moving, collaborative agency environment.
Key Responsibilities
Conduct keyword research, SEO audits, and competitor analysis
Optimise website content, metadata, headings, and internal linking structures
Monitor technical SEO issues, identify fixes, and work with developers when needed
Manage and optimise Google Business Profiles for local SEO clients
Analyse and report on performance using tools like Google Analytics, Search Console, SEMrush, and Ahrefs
Keep up with industry updates and best practices to improve client results
